Default Calipers go BLING! BLING!

My simple 12 bolt install has turned into an overhaul of my braking system.....remove ABS, change lines, replace the pads, and make them look one of a kind.

After a long debate about powdercoated or polished, I decided on both. I just didn't like the idea of polishing that iron and having to clear coat it. It took a little time to smooth everything out, the pits are deep and that iron caliper mount is tough! I really smoothed the caliper mount up nice and it really shows. The powdercoat looks flawless. It's bright mirror red with a clear topcoat. The only thing that upset me a little was polishing most of the back side of the caliper only to figure out it won't be seen!! Oh well, atleast it's lighter. <img border="0" title="" alt="[Wink]" src="gr_images/icons/wink.gif" />
